Output a958df5c4e33b30af3ebf7785a6aaf45be00a03e40b15d2e53dcdb28d5c16096:17

value
27270
script pubkey
OP_0 OP_PUSHBYTES_20 c395b496f7fe7c3d3f2a4a949572bc6fc26b5abd
address
bc1qcw2mf9hhle7r60e2f22f2u4udlpxkk4a0enl89
transaction
a958df5c4e33b30af3ebf7785a6aaf45be00a03e40b15d2e53dcdb28d5c16096